

Jackson Weatherbee Tarbell Kennedy of Toms River, NJ died Monday, January 19, 2015. Born June 28, 1939, he was a son of the late Lilian Tarbell Kennedy and Captain Anthony Kennedy, Jr. Family and friends are invited to a memorial service at The Presbyterian Church of Toms River, 1070 Hooper Avenue, Toms River, New Jersey on Saturday, January 31 at 11 am. A second memorial service will be held this summer in Eagles Mere, Pennsylvania.
He is survived by wife, Patricia; children: Elizabeth “Lisa” Kennedy Duke of Cary, NC, Richard “Paca” Kennedy II of Los Angeles, CA, and Alexandra “Looie” Kennedy Gittines of Southbury, CT; step-children: Andrea Moore of New Fairfield, CT and Randy Moore of Southern Pines, NC; brother, Anthony Kennedy III of Muncy, PA; and grand-children: Cannon, Jackson, Avalon, Lili, Isabel, and Ada. He is preceded in death by his brother, Richard Kennedy.
Lt. Kennedy attended Episcopal Academy in Merion, PA. He graduated from the US Naval Academy, Class of 1961. He served as Operations Officer on the USS York County (LST-1175), Executive Officer on the USS New London County (LST-1066), and Weapons Officer on the USS Waldron (DD-699) as part of the NASA Gemini Recovery Team. He graduated with his Masters in Architecture from Penn State University. He designed and constructed residential houses and commercial buildings during his long career as an architect.
Lt. Kennedy was a member and served on committees of the Eagles Mere Presbyterian Church in Eagles Mere, PA. He enjoyed membership and Bible study at the Presbyterian Church in Toms River, NJ.
